Agenda Item Text:
Approve Reimbursement Grant from the 100 Club of Arizona, not to exceed $10,000, for the purchase of 5 automated external defibrillators.
Background:
An AED is a lightweight, battery-operated, portable device that checks the heart's rhythm and sends a shock to the heart to restore a normal rhythm. The device is used to help people having sudden cardiac arrest. The Sheriff's Office currently has 20 AED's. Three of those AED's have failed and all of them are at their end of life. The purchase of these 5 AED's will be to replace some of the current supply which are beyond their working life.
Department's Next Steps (if approved):
If approved, the Sheriff's Office will move forward with the purchase of the 5 new AED and submit for reimbursement through the 100 Club of Arizona.
Impact of NOT Approving/Alternatives:
If not approved, the current AED's will continue to fail and the Sheriff's Office and Search and Rescue will not be able to provide life saving measures to the level we currently have.
